Why do so many people assume that a woman trying to live by Catholic moral standards of sexuality is a nun? This is not just a Catholic standard; it is also a Christian standard. Not only that, it is a standard that applies to men, as well–both Christian and Catholic.

Here is a clarification. There is the general category, Women. Inside that category are subsets, one of which is Catholic (that is my set). Inside the Catholic Women subset is a smaller subset, Nun. In other words, every Catholic nun is a Catholic woman but not all Catholic women are nuns. Does everyone understand now?
